在 WordPress 3.0 开工的时候,就已经正式对外公布了本次更新最大的一个亮点,就是将 WordPress MU 与 WordPress 进行功能上的合并。这也就意味着,从 3.0 开始,WordPress 将真正意义上的支持多用户、多站点功能。
这几天,WordPress 3.0 的第一个 Beta 版本也对外发布了,虽然还处于紧张的开发调试阶段,但大家不妨先行进行一些测试。也好为以后的开发工作积累一些经验。
3.0 的多站点(Multisite)功能从最开始合并完毕后,直接可以在后台点击激活,到现在需要经过一些配置才可以使用,估计是考虑到某些用户可能会误点击 而导致不必要的麻烦发生。
下面就介绍一下如何激活 WordPress 3.0 的多站点支持功能:
第一步,当然是下载最新版的 WordPress 程序,并进行安装。和以前的安装步骤并没有什么区别。
第二步,将以下代码加入到 wp-config.php 文件当中:
第三步,在 wp-content 目录中创建一个 blogs.dir 目录,用于存储子站点用户上传数据。
第四步,在后台的“Tools”(工具)菜单中会多出一个“Network”(网络)的项目。点击进入……
第五步,根据页面提示,对 wp-config.php 文件进行修改。(切记,修改前请备份。)
第六步,根据页面提示,覆盖 .htaccess 文件中的内容。(切记,修改前请备份。)
好了,通过以上六步的设置,现在刷新一下后台,也许会要求重新登陆。看一下原来左侧的导航栏上,是不是多出来一个“Super Admin”(超级管理)的栏目?点击里面各个功能项,如果您之前使用过 MU,您一定会觉得特别亲切。
在启用多站点功能之前,有几点需要大家注意:
第一,做好 wp-config.php 文件和 .htaccess 文件的备份。只要备份在手,恢复到单站点模式将易如反掌。
第二,在启用之前,请尽量将站点链接形式从默认形式改为其他形式。
第三,您的主机必须支持 Rewrite 功能。否则,您看到这里,属于浪费时间。
本文来源 Dreamcolor's Cote